Grain whisky rarely gets to be the main event. Nikka Coffey Grain makes the case that it should. Distilled primarily from corn in a continuous Coffey still and matured in old American oak casks, it delivers a style of whisky that has no real European equivalent — sweet, tropical and disarmingly drinkable. Mango, papaya, coconut and candied orange peel over a toffee base. Complexity that doesn’t announce itself.
Nose: Tropical fruit, vanilla, coconut and candied orange peel.
Palate: Sweet and mellow with melon, peach, grapefruit and toffee popcorn.
Finish: Rich oak and marmalade with a clean, fresh close.
45% ABV. Japanese grain whisky.
